At KFT in Brockwood, Hampshire, we have begun the second phase of our project to digitize all of Krishnamurti’s video recordings. Last year we captured all of the archive master tapes. We are now on to production master tapes, which include dubbed languages. We are working more than eighteen hours a day on this, making best use of the rented video players. I am on the early shift, which means six o’clock starts. We are using Final Cut Pro, Matrox MX02, on eight-core Mac Pros, capturing to 10-bit uncompressed QuickTime. Each hour we digitize takes up 95GB of disk space, backing everything up on 2TB drives and then LTO-4 tape. After a month of this, we will be able to focus on releasing most of the video titles on DVD and video download.
